How to Get Your Team to Embrace AI: Leadership, Training & The Why
02 Oct 2025
Episode: How to Get Your Team to Embrace AI: Leadership, Training & The WhyHost: Donna Peterson, World InnovatorsEpisode Summary-Many forward-thinking CEOs and leaders are embracing AI — but struggle with one key challenge: how to get their teams on board. In this episode of the B2B Marketing Excellence & AI Podcast, host Donna Peterson shares practical strategies to inspire buy-in, align employees with AI tools, and create a culture of experimentation.Drawing from leadership principles and her own journey with ChatGPT, Donna explains why defining the “why” is critical, how transparency builds trust, and why training and one-on-one conversations are essential to long-term adoption. You’ll also hear examples of how leaders can introduce AI in simple, personal ways that reduce overwhelm and spark curiosity.If you’re a leader trying to integrate AI into your business, this 16-minute episode will help you move beyond resistance and turn your team into active adopters of AI.Key Takeaways You Can Implement Right Away-Start with the why. Explain why AI matters for the company — and help each team member find their personal why.Be transparent. Share your own AI journey, including doubts, failures, and wins.Encourage curiosity. Create space for experimentation; not every AI use case has to stick long-term.Invest in training. Don’t expect employees to learn AI on their own — provide workshops and accountability sessions.One-on-one conversations matter. Personal discussions help employees connect AI with their specific goals and tasks.Start simple and personal. Show fun, everyday uses (recipes, sports training, book summaries) to break down barriers.Make it ongoing.
